#853748 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#853748 is composed of 52.2% red, 21.6%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.6% magenta, 45.9%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 346.9 degrees, a saturation of 41.5% and a lightness of 36.9%. #853748 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6e90 with #0b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

● #853748 color description : Dark moderate red.
#853748 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#853748 has RGB values of R:133, G:55,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.46,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8730440.

Shades and Tints of #853748
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080304 is the darkest color, while #fdf9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#853748
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#615b5c is the less saturated color, while #b8042b is the most saturated one.
